最近看到群里面经常讨论大型应用中`SQL`的管理办法,有人说用`EF`/`EF Core`,但很多人不信任它生成`SQL`的语句;有人说用`Dapper`,但将`SQL`写到代码中有些人觉得不合适;有人提出用存储过程,但现在舆论纷纷反对这种做法;有人提出了`iBatis.NET`,它可以配置确保高灵... ...
分类:
数据库 时间:
2020-01-09 23:03:16
阅读次数:
196
crontab 基本语法 参数 特殊参数 案例 ...
分类:
系统相关 时间:
2020-01-09 22:53:50
阅读次数:
109
1. 示意图 2. 基本语法 3. 参数细节说明 4. 案例 ...
分类:
系统相关 时间:
2020-01-09 21:05:46
阅读次数:
118
MySQL视图、存储过程与存储引擎一、前言?前面的文章已经介绍了MySQL的索引与事务以及MySQL的备份与恢复的相关的内容,本文将对MySQL视图及存储过程以及存储引擎进行讲述。二、MySQL视图2.1问题引出——视图的概念?我们在使用SQL语句进行多表查询的时候的命令是非常冗长而麻烦的,如果说这样的操作还非常多的使用的情况下就会加大工作人员的工作量,毕竟不能保证如此长的代码不会写错,并且多次进
分类:
数据库 时间:
2020-01-09 15:59:19
阅读次数:
94
数据表使用的是orcale数据库自带的SCOTT用户下的表,主要使用就是EMP(雇员表)和DEPT(部门表),表中有部分数据。 这个用户默认是锁定的,需要登录有DBA权限的用户对他进行解锁,解锁语句如下 alter user scott account unlock; 解锁完之后就可以进行登录和使用 ...
分类:
数据库 时间:
2020-01-09 13:04:27
阅读次数:
116
Dapper 第一篇简单介绍什么是小巧玲珑?Dapper如何工作安装需求方法参数结果常用类型 Dapper 第二篇 Execute 方法介绍描述存储过程Insert语句Update语句Delete语句示例: Dapper 第三篇 Query方法讲解示例:查询匿名示例:强类型查询示例:查询多映射(一对 ...
分类:
移动开发 时间:
2020-01-09 00:59:07
阅读次数:
125
Bat脚本备份sqlserver 表结构、存储过程、指定表数据: @echo off cd /d %~dp0 ::备份表结构、存储过程和部分配置表的数据 set LogFile=report.log set servername="192.168.43.9" set DBname="TEST" se ...
分类:
数据库 时间:
2020-01-08 14:46:34
阅读次数:
98
如果返回一个 数字或者字符 比较简单,那么多行多列怎么办呢,分为以下几种情况 【东西很多,这里只做简单列举】 返回多行单列 又分为几种方式 1. return next,用在 for 循环中 CREATE OR REPLACE FUNCTION funcname ( in_id integer) R ...
分类:
其他好文 时间:
2020-01-07 17:50:05
阅读次数:
299
1.简介 MyBatis事一个半自动化的持久层框架 2.mybatis与jdbc和hibernate的比较 jdbc:sql夹在Java代码块里,耦合度高,容易导致硬编码内伤 维护也不方便,因为直接写死了 hibernate:内部自动生成sql,但是不容易维护优化 基于全映射的全自动框架,字段过多, ...
分类:
其他好文 时间:
2020-01-07 15:59:41
阅读次数:
86
select * from UserInfo 添加存储过程 if OBJECT_ID('P_add') is not nulldrop proc P_addgocreate proc P_add--参数@UserName varchar(100),@UserPwd varchar(100),@Use ...
分类:
其他好文 时间:
2020-01-07 10:35:09
阅读次数:
89